Mister Rogers’ Neighborhood Season 3 Episode 44
Rogers brings two gerbils to his television house. On a visit to the McFeelys’ house, he finds Mr. McFeely looking after a Saint Bernard. In the Neighborhood of Make-Believe, Bob Dog is practicing for his role in the play “Let the Vet Get the Pet”, but it isn’t easy.
